  • In South Carolina, a bill that would review South Carolina’s juvenile justice laws was approved by a subcommittee of the legislature. House Bill 3055 authorizes a new legislative committee to make recommendations to the General Assembly on ways to divert more juveniles from the criminal justice system.
  • In Colorado, officials in Larimer County approved the position of a diversion program coordinator who would be responsible for two juvenile diversion programs. The programs would work closely with school resource officers in diverting lower-level incidents within the school system away from the juvenile justice system.
